Heat Transfer Models And Thermal Conduction Properties Of Laminated Fiber Core Materials Of Vacuum Insulation Panels

Vacuum insulation panels(VIPs)are generally considered as super insulation materials,Due to high porosity of the core material and the high vacuum,VIPs’ thermal conductivity are extremely low and has been used for exterior insulation of buildings which have very high insulation requirements.Laminated glass fiber and glass wool are important fiber core materials of VIPs.Therefore,to understand the influential factors and the influential law of these two kinds of fiber core is of great significance to the VIPs production.In this paper,the microstructures of the two kinds of laminated fiber core materials were characterized by scanning electron microscopy.It was found that fibers in a layer of laminated fiberglass core materials are distributed randomly in the plane perpendicular to the thickness of the fiberglass layer.Meanwhile,fibers in a layer of laminated glass wool core materials are not only randomly distributed in the plane perpendicular to the thickness direction of the fiber layer,but also have certain random distribution in the thickness direction of the fiber layer.The diameter and length of fibers in the two kinds of core materials were measured by a digital micrometer and a vernier caliper.The pore size of the two kinds of laminated fiber core materials was determined according to the fiber distribution characteristics in fiber layers and the related core material parameters measured.Based on the the fiber structure tests,the structures of the two core materials are reconstructed.Two heat transfer models were proposed to calculate the equivalent thermal conductivity(ETC)of the two kinds of laminated fibers separately.The two models were tested by the experimental data and theoretical results provided by other researchers.The effects of temperature,pressure,fiber diameter,fiber volume fraction,fiber length and single-layer thickness on VIPs core ETC were studied.The results show that the equivalent thermal conductivities of the two kinds of laminated fiber core materials decrease with temperature,pressure and fiber diameter decreases.The ETCs of glass wool core materials decrease with the decrease of the thickness of single layer and the increase of fiber length.The ETCs of the two kinds of laminated fiber core materials do not change linearly with the increase of fiber volume fraction.They decrease firstly and then increase,which indicates that there exists an optimum fiber volume fraction leading the minimum thermal conductivity of core materials.The optimum volume fraction and minimum thermal conductivity of laminated fiber core materials are different when the temperature,pressure,fiber diameter,fiber length and thickness of single layer are different.The optimum volume fraction and minimum thermal conductivity of the core materials under different conditions were calculated in order to provide reference for VIPs manufactures.
